Description

Become A Part of the El Programa Hispano Catòlico Team

El Programa Hispano Católico (EPHC) is an organization that supports individuals in reaching their fullest potential. For nearly 40 years, our mission has been to advance racial equity and social justice through the power of our Latine roots, culture, and community. This mission, which is at the heart of everything we do, has allowed us to respond to local needs by addressing the social determinants of health.

We achieve this through our program areas:
Housing, Economic Sustainability, Education, Community Wellness, and DV/SA Prevention and Intervention. Today, EPHC serves more than 30,000 people annually and employs over 100 staff members, the majority of whom are bilingual, and over 93% are bicultural.

Although EPHC is affiliated with the Catholic Charities Network, candidates or participants do not need to be Catholic to work with us or receive services. Across our programs and services, staff of all faiths-or none-work within our framework of respect for our mission, the dignity of the human person, and the common good.

About

The Role

The Adult Wellness Program Coordinator provides leadership and day-to-day oversight for the Hermandad Program, ensuring high-quality, culturally responsive services that promote the well-being, social connection, and independence of older adults. This role coordinates program operations including outreach, workshops, social activities, congregate meals, transportation services, and community partnerships. The Program Coordinator supervises program staff and volunteers, leading recruitment, training, and coaching. The role is responsible for monitoring program quality, budget adherence, & overseeing accurate data collection and documentation.

Principle

Duties & Responsibilities Program Coordination & Facilitation
  • Coordinates Hermandad Program service operations in collaboration with Adult Wellness staff
  • Develops strong partnerships with local organizations, clinics, and community leaders to expand program reach
  • Develop and lead culturally responsive outreach strategies tailored to diverse communities.
  • Coordinates social activities and workshops to promote emotional well-being and community building for older adults
  • Supports congregate meals and activities, overseeing adherence to nutrition standards
  • Leads coordination of transportation services for older adults
  • Provides culturally specific referrals and assistance in-person and by phone, connecting participants with community resources and nutrition services.
  • Maintains effective coordination and communication with partners, program presenters and facilitators to enhance program support
Supervisory Responsibilities
  • Lead and oversee recruitment, hiring, training, coaching of assigned program staff and volunteers
